SWK 3220 Social Work Practice II


3 Hours

Prerequisites: SWK 3210 .

The second of three practice courses in the social work curriculum, this course is designed to equip students with the necessary knowledge, values, and skills to effectively engage, assess, intervene, and facilitate groups within diverse generalist practice environments. Through practical exercises, case discussions, and experiential learning students will gain insight into the dynamics of group interactions, develop leadership skills, and understand the role of social workers in fostering positive change in the context of groups.
